- [ ] **Step 7: Breaker override escrow.** After sealing the signing keys for the Tallgrove upstream API circuit breaker, confirm the support team can force the breaker open during a full outage. The override bundle lives in the sealed escrow drawer and is useless without its unlock phrase. Two ceremony witnesses must initial this step before proceeding. The escrow bundle is decrypted with the recovery passphrase that follows.

vault phrase of kahip-kahop = holath-quenmir

FAQ: What if I'm locked out of the Hueledger audit workspace?

Contractors running the color-contrast audit for the Marrowgate redesign sometimes lose access after the weekly permission sweep. Don't create a new account; that breaks audit attribution. Instead, open the Hueledger recovery prompt, confirm your assigned component list, and enter the team passphrase printed directly beneath this answer.

unlock words, bagug-kadup: wenath-zorael

Alert: tilecache-miss-ratio-high. Miss ratio on the Verdanmap tile-rendering cache exceeded 60% for 10 minutes. Renderer pool is saturating; map loads in the Orlin region are degraded. Likely causes: cache eviction storm after a style deploy, or a warmer job failure. Check the warmer first; do not flush the cache manually. Full triage flow and rollback criteria are documented on the page below.

runbook for taduf-kawef: https://confluence.qorvelsys.internal/projects/display/display/pages